Cheapest Available Spring Garden 1 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Spring Garden of Philadelphia, PA is the One Bedroom Model starting from $1,100 at Apartments @ 1220.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Spring Garden is currently $2,209.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Spring Garden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Spring Garden with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Spring Garden is at Apartments @ 1220 listed at $1,100.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Spring Garden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Spring Garden is $2,209.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Spring Garden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Spring Garden is a 1,215 square feet unit starting from $3,096 at The Lofts At 1835 Arch.

What is the average size for Spring Garden 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Spring Garden is currently 1,053 sq ft.
